"So now that we have our two minor down and our five seven we can start what we walk, what Jazz cats call, walking a two five. Very basic Jazz vocabulary going from your two minor to your five seven. So our A minor to our D seven and we can just keep walking back and forth. I'll do two measures of each. Then one measure each. Then a half measure each and you'll hear the basic sound and you'll hear how we run it through A.D, G, A, D, G, A ,D, G, A, A, D, G, A, D, D. So go through and start working on your two fives in every key."
